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Progresh Sports Complex (Thornton, CO)
Progresh Sports Complex is located in Thornton, a suburban city in the northern part of the Denver metropolitan area. Situated just east of I-25, it offers convenient access for travelers. The primary access roads for the complex are Washington Street and 49th Avenue. Parking is generally available in lots surrounding the fields, though specific zones may be designated for teams or officials during events. For those flying in, Denver International Airport (DEN) is the closest major airport, approximately a 30-40 minute drive east depending on traffic. Driving into the complex, especially during peak event times, can involve congestion along Washington Street and connecting arterial roads. Arriving 30-45 minutes before your scheduled game or event is advisable to allow ample time for parking, team check-in, and field setup. Rideshare services are available but may experience delays or pickup point challenges during large events. Consider utilizing nearby park-and-ride lots with public transit connections if seeking to avoid direct event traffic.

Game Day Flow
Check-In & Warm-Up
When arriving at Progresh Sports Complex for your event, aim for your designated arrival window, typically 45-60 minutes prior to your first game. This buffer allows your team to navigate parking, locate your assigned fields, and begin any necessary warm-up routines. Familiarize yourself with the complex layout upon arrival; designated team check-in areas or field marshals will guide you on specific protocols. Make sure all necessary gear, water, and team supplies are easily accessible from your parking spot or designated team area. Early arrival also ensures you can secure optimal warm-up space, which can be limited on busy event days.
Mid-Day Regroup
For events with breaks between games or during longer tournament days, planning a midday regroup is essential for maintaining team energy. Utilize shaded areas or designated team gathering spots within or immediately adjacent to the complex for rest and hydration. Pack coolers with ample water, snacks, and easy-to-eat lunches that can be consumed quickly. This period is also ideal for coaches to debrief with players and for families to connect. If the complex offers concessions, check their operating hours and offerings in advance, but self-sufficiency with team provisions is often more reliable.
Wrap-Up & Departure
As your final game concludes, coordinate your team's departure efficiently. Ensure all personal belongings and team equipment are collected and that the team area is left clean. Be prepared for potential traffic delays as many other teams and spectators will be exiting simultaneously. Allow extra time for navigating out of the parking lots, especially if your event is one of the last to finish. If possible, designate a post-event gathering spot away from the immediate exit to allow for a more relaxed team debrief or a quick team photo without causing further congestion.

Weather & Seasons at Progresh Sports Complex
- Winter: Winter in Thornton means cold temperatures, with daytime highs often in the 30s and 40s Fahrenheit. Expect frosty mornings and the possibility of snow, which can occasionally lead to field closures or adjusted schedules. Layers are essential for players and spectators, including hats, gloves, and warm coats. Visibility can be reduced during snow events, impacting travel times to and from the complex.
- Spring & early summer: Spring brings a warming trend, with temperatures rising into the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it, though cold snaps can still occur. Early summer continues this warming, with highs typically in the 70s and 80s. This period is prime for sports, but afternoon thunderstorms are common, so be prepared for sudden downpours and lightning delays. Pack lightweight, breathable clothing, but keep a rain jacket handy.
- Mid-summer: July and August are generally the warmest months, with average daytime temperatures in the high 80s to low 90s Fahrenheit. Humidity can sometimes make it feel hotter, and strong sun exposure is a significant factor. Staying hydrated is critical for athletes and fans. Sunscreen, hats, and seeking shade during breaks are highly recommended. Evening games are often more comfortable than mid-day ones.
- Fall season: Fall offers crisp air and cooling temperatures, with daytime highs typically ranging from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it in September, gradually dropping into the 40s and 50s by late October. This is a beautiful season for outdoor events, though mornings can be chilly. Pack layers, including long sleeves, light jackets, and perhaps a warmer coat for cooler evenings. The fall colors can make for a pleasant backdrop to games.
- Rain & snow: Rain can occur year-round but is most common during spring and summer thunderstorms. These events can cause significant delays or cancellations. Snow is typical from late fall through early spring, ranging from light dustings to heavier accumulations. Field conditions can become muddy or frozen, impacting play. Always check event status with organizers during inclement weather, and allow extra travel time if conditions are poor.
